这比手动拼接字符串要方便得多,也更不容易出错。
关键是做好参数校验与错误处理,确保系统稳定可靠。
选择依据包括文件大小、性能要求及操作复杂度。
最常见的,也是我前面提到过的,就是作为内部使用的提示符。
if ($U['isactive']):这是核心的过滤条件。
效率: 这种基于NumPy数组操作的列表推导式通常比使用Pandas的apply方法(特别是当axis=1时)更为高效,因为它避免了Pandas Series对象的创建开销,直接在NumPy数组上进行操作。
$ap[1] + $bp[1]: 将两个指数相加。
浮点数运算的精度问题 在计算机中,浮点数(如Python中的float,NumPy中的np.float64)的表示是有限精度的。
管理PHP函数库的核心在于模块化、可维护性与团队协作。
") exit() # 使用正则表达式提取设备名称 # 模式:device-任意字符-数字-数字 空格 任意字符 txt_device_names = re.findall(r"(device-\w+-\d+-\d+ \w+)", text_data) print("从文本文件提取的设备名称:", txt_device_names) # 3. 遍历 JSON 数据,查找匹配项并提取信息 print("\n开始匹配JSON数据并提取URL:") if not json_data.get("results"): print("JSON文件中没有 'results' 键或其为空。
package singleton import ( 立即学习“go语言免费学习笔记(深入)”; "sync" ) // 定义单例结构体 type Singleton struct { Data string } var ( instance *Singleton once sync.Once ) // GetInstance 返回唯一的实例 func GetInstance() *Singleton { once.Do(func() { instance = &Singleton{ 无阶未来模型擂台/AI 应用平台 无阶未来模型擂台/AI 应用平台,一站式模型+应用平台 35 查看详情 Data: "initialized", } }) return instance } 直接初始化(包加载时创建) 如果不需要延迟初始化,可以在包加载时直接创建实例。
例如Logback中使用AsyncAppender: <appender name="ASYNC" class="ch.qos.logback.classic.AsyncAppender"> <appender-ref ref="FILE" /> </appender>异步模式将日志事件提交到队列,由单独线程处理写入磁盘,显著降低主线程等待时间。
基本上就这些。
配合良好的代码结构和缓存策略,PHP应用的数据库性能可以得到明显提升。
users[id] = userToModify:最后,将修改后的userToModify副本重新赋值给usersmap中键id的位置。
在PHP中执行LDAP搜索是获取目录信息的核心操作。
更重要的是,它具备良好的扩展性,当行业需求变化,需要新增数据字段时,XML能够相对容易地进行扩展而不会破坏现有结构。
这通常是因为 Apache 服务器没有正确配置以处理像 Nginx 那样将所有请求重定向到 index.php 的路由规则。
你可以用它来指代具体图形,但不能写 Shape s; 这样的代码。
它们通常通过g->Defer(g是当前goroutine的结构体指针)这样的内部字段来管理。
本文链接:http://www.ensosoft.com/15593_7276f5.html